Adaptive Helm has a 61.26% win rate in TFT Set 16. This Adaptive Helm data is based on 18,529 matches and is updated regularly to reflect the current meta. Adaptive Helm has achieved 11,354 victories with an average placement of 3.90 and a 17.64% first place rate.
Adaptive Helm has a 61.26% win rate and 16.06% pick rate, with an average placement of 3.90. Adaptive Helm is rated as S-tier in the current meta. This makes Adaptive Helm a strong item and highly recommended for competitive play.
